First off, it’s important to understand what flannel is. Flannel is a soft, loosely woven fabric that’s typically made from wool, cotton, or a blend of the two. The fibers in flannel are carded to create a fuzzy surface, which gives it that cozy, warm feel we all love. Now, when it comes to weight, it really depends on a few factors.
The material plays a huge role. Wool flannel blankets tend to be heavier than cotton ones. Wool is a dense, natural fiber that provides excellent insulation. It can hold a lot of warmth, but that also means it adds some heft. For example, a thick wool flannel blanket might weigh anywhere from 5 to 10 pounds, depending on its size. On the other hand, cotton flannel is lighter. Cotton is a more breathable fiber, and a cotton flannel blanket might weigh around 3 to 6 pounds.
The size of the blanket also matters. Obviously, a king – sized flannel blanket is going to be heavier than a twin – sized one. A king – sized wool flannel could easily tip the scales at 8 to 10 pounds, while a twin – sized cotton flannel might only weigh 3 pounds or so.
Another factor is the thickness of the fabric. Some flannel blankets are made with a thicker weave, which adds weight. Thicker blankets are great for cold winter nights as they offer more insulation. But if you’re looking for something lighter, there are thinner flannel options available too.
Now, let’s talk about the pros and cons of heavy and light flannel blankets. Heavy flannel blankets are great for those really cold nights. They wrap you up like a warm hug and keep you toasty. If you live in a cold climate or like to sleep in a really cold room, a heavy flannel blanket is a great choice. They also tend to be more durable, as the thicker fabric can withstand more wear and tear.
On the flip side, light flannel blankets are more versatile. You can use them year – round. In the summer, they’re light enough to keep you comfortable without overheating. They’re also easier to handle and wash. If you have a smaller bed or just prefer a lighter cover, a light flannel blanket is the way to go.
